Before we talk about which collagen is best for gut health, let's get acquainted with this superstar protein. Collagen is the most abundant protein in your body, literally holding you together. Think of it as the scaffolding and glue for your entire body, making up approximately 30% of your total protein mass. It's the primary structural component of your skin, bones, tendons, ligaments, and cartilage. But here's a crucial detail often overlooked: it's also a vital component of your organs, blood vessels, and, yes, your intestinal lining.
Composed mainly of three amino acids – proline, glycine, and hydroxyproline – collagen forms strong, rope-like triple helix structures. Your body also needs essential cofactors like Vitamin C, zinc, copper, and manganese to produce and maintain these intricate structures effectively.

As we age, our body's natural collagen production unfortunately slows down. Starting in our mid-20s, and particularly after age 60 or during menopause for women, existing collagen breaks down faster, and the new collagen produced is often of lower quality. This decline can manifest in visible ways, like wrinkles or sagging skin, but it also has profound effects internally, impacting everything from joint flexibility to the integrity of your gut lining.

Now, let's zero in on the gut. Your digestive tract is a marvel of biological engineering, acting as a sophisticated barrier between the outside world (the food you eat, the microbes you ingest) and your internal environment. Imagine it as a highly selective gatekeeper, deciding what nutrients get absorbed into your bloodstream and what waste gets ushered out. A healthy intestinal lining is critical for this process, preventing unwanted substances from "leaking" through and potentially triggering an immune response or systemic inflammation.
This intestinal lining is lined with a single layer of cells held together by "tight junctions." When these tight junctions become compromised, it can lead to increased intestinal permeability, often referred to as a "leaky gut" in wellness circles. While we can't make claims about treating specific diseases, maintaining the integrity of this gut barrier is paramount for overall digestive comfort and health.
So, where does collagen fit in? While the term "leaky gut" is a functional health concept and not an FDA-recognized medical diagnosis, the science points to collagen's components as vital for supporting the normal structure and function of the intestinal lining.
While research on collagen's direct effects on the gut microbiome is still evolving, some studies suggest it may positively influence microbial balance, further contributing to a healthy digestive environment.

The most common sources for collagen supplements are bovine (from cows) and marine (from fish).
For gut health, both bovine and marine collagen peptides can be beneficial due to their high content of Type I and Type III amino acids. The "best" often comes down to personal preference, dietary restrictions, and sourcing quality.
As discussed, regardless of the source, ensure your collagen supplement is hydrolyzed or labeled as collagen peptides. This pre-digested form ensures maximum absorption, meaning your body can actually utilize the amino acids to do their important work in your gut and beyond.

The gut-brain axis is a powerful connection. Chronic stress can wreak havoc on your digestive system, influencing gut motility, nutrient absorption, and even the balance of your gut microbiome. Practices like mindfulness, meditation, yoga, spending time in nature, or even just deep breathing exercises can significantly support your gut health.
Sleep is your body's repair mode. During deep sleep, your body has the opportunity to repair and rejuvenate cells, including those in your gut lining.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night. Establish a consistent sleep schedule and create a relaxing bedtime routine to optimize your body's natural restorative processes.
Regular physical activity can improve gut motility, reduce stress, and even positively impact the diversity of your gut microbiome. Find an activity you enjoy and make it a consistent part of your routine.
Slow down when you eat. Chew your food thoroughly. These simple acts can significantly reduce the burden on your digestive system, allowing enzymes to work more effectively and signaling your body to properly digest and absorb nutrients.
